Savitha,

You don¹t manually need to add jars to
"/oozie-3.3.2/distro/target/oozie-3.3.2-distro/oozie-3.3.2/oozie-server/web
apps/oozie/WEB-INF/lib". The contents of libext will be injected to that 
location. Also you don¹t need to put those same jars in 
"oozie-3.3.2/distro/target/oozie-3.3.2-distro/oozie-3.3.2/lib/³. This location 
is not used by tomcat for classpath as far as I can see.

So just fix the contents of the libext to include all hadoop, derby related 
jars and rerun the oozie-setup step
